Output 675ccb1e025543ed62c0cc1072d17a96f530b947430d0109f6d0d859ab6935ec:2

value
15576468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9067784d93a11b6c8a94b925eb97ac0d0b2f57aa OP_EQUAL
address
MM4hVGfDpsBysPCzCvNUGce3r6rkJGa72Y
transaction
675ccb1e025543ed62c0cc1072d17a96f530b947430d0109f6d0d859ab6935ec
spent
true